"Scientists studied people who got hitched between 2005 and 2012 and discovered about 7.6 percent of couples who met face-to-face reported marriage break-ups, compared to only about 6 percent of those who met online. And the results held true even when researchers controlled for things like demographic differences, says the study’s lead author, John Cacioppo, Ph.D."
